Output ec58ff1d8ed059149191a6d80ca002f27c8b1db527ec7c2eda01948fbdb16ff2:1

value
496013
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68b384952d45fc20b721d9de25d3a1190b112b52 OP_EQUAL
address
3BEdFciNxqbZEUq7PEYKDibCZJ17xWzexv
transaction
ec58ff1d8ed059149191a6d80ca002f27c8b1db527ec7c2eda01948fbdb16ff2
spent
true